? 深度学习入门必看!2025 免费系统化教材 + PyTorch 代码示例,开启实战之旅
想入门深度学习却被复杂的理论和代码劝退?2025 年这套免费系统化教材搭配 PyTorch 代码示例,绝对能让你轻松上手!它不仅涵盖深度学习核心概念,还提供可直接运行的代码,让你在实践中快速掌握技能。
? 教材亮点:免费且系统化的学习资源
这套教材最大的优势就是完全免费,无论是学生还是职场人士,都能无门槛获取。教材内容从基础的张量运算、神经网络结构讲起,逐步深入到卷积神经网络、循环神经网络等复杂模型,最后还涉及自然语言处理、计算机视觉等实际应用领域。每个章节都配有详细的数学推导和图示,帮助读者理解算法原理。
教材的结构设计也非常科学,分为基础篇、现代技术篇和应用拓展篇。基础篇适合零基础读者,从线性代数、Python 编程等预备知识开始,逐步引导读者掌握深度学习的基本概念。现代技术篇则聚焦于近年来的热门技术,如注意力机制、Transformer 架构等,让读者紧跟技术潮流。应用拓展篇通过实际案例,如房价预测、图像分类等,帮助读者将理论知识应用到实际项目中。
? PyTorch 代码示例:从理论到实践的桥梁
教材的另一个核心优势是提供了大量基于 PyTorch 的代码示例。PyTorch 作为当前最流行的深度学习框架之一,以其动态计算图和简洁的 API 受到广泛欢迎。教材中的代码示例不仅完整,而且注释详细,读者可以直接运行代码,观察模型的训练过程和输出结果。
以线性回归为例,教材中提供了生成数据、定义模型、训练模型的完整代码。通过运行这段代码,读者可以直观地看到模型如何通过梯度下降算法优化参数,最终实现对数据的拟合。此外,教材还包含语义分割网络(U-Net)的实现示例,展示了深度学习在计算机视觉领域的应用。
对于自然语言处理任务,教材提供了基于 Transformer 架构的机器翻译代码示例。读者可以学习如何使用 PyTorch 构建编码器 - 解码器模型,处理序列到序列的翻译任务。这些代码示例不仅帮助读者理解算法原理,还能培养实际项目的开发能力。
? 配套资源:助力深度学习之旅
除了教材和代码示例,还有丰富的配套资源可供使用。教材的官方 GitHub 仓库提供了所有章节的 Jupyter Notebook 文件,读者可以在本地环境中运行代码,进行交互式学习。此外,仓库还包含数据集和预训练模型,方便读者进行实验和调试。
教材的在线社区也非常活跃,读者可以在社区中提问、交流学习心得。社区中的答疑和经验分享能够帮助读者解决学习过程中遇到的问题,加速学习进程。对于需要进一步提升的读者,教材还推荐了相关的论文和在线课程,如斯坦福大学的 CS231n 计算机视觉课程、DeepLearning.AI 的深度学习专项课程等。
? 与其他资源的对比:为何选择这套教材?
与其他深度学习教材相比,这套教材有以下几个显著优势:
- 免费且开源:相比一些收费教材或课程,这套教材完全免费,降低了学习门槛。
- 代码驱动学习:通过可运行的代码示例,读者能够快速将理论知识转化为实践能力。
- 多框架支持:教材不仅提供 PyTorch 实现,还包含 TensorFlow 和 MXNet 的代码,适合不同需求的读者。
- 紧跟技术前沿:教材内容涵盖了注意力机制、Transformer 架构等最新技术,确保读者学习到最前沿的知识。
- 教学资源丰富:配套的在线课程、社区支持和论文推荐,为读者提供了全方位的学习支持。
? 学习建议:如何高效利用教材?
- 按章节逐步学习:教材的章节安排由浅入深,建议读者按照顺序学习,逐步掌握深度学习的核心知识。
- 动手实践代码:运行教材中的代码示例,并尝试修改参数和模型结构,观察结果的变化,加深理解。
- 参与社区讨论:在社区中与其他学习者交流,解决问题,分享学习心得。
- 结合实际项目:选择一个感兴趣的项目,如图像分类或文本生成,运用所学知识进行实践。
- 关注技术动态:定期阅读相关论文和博客,了解深度学习领域的最新进展。
? 总结:开启深度学习实践之旅
2025 年这套免费系统化教材搭配 PyTorch 代码示例,是深度学习入门的绝佳选择。它以免费、系统化、代码驱动的特点,帮助读者快速掌握深度学习的核心知识和技能。无论是零基础的初学者,还是希望进一步提升的开发者,都能从这套教材中获得有价值的学习资源。
立即行动起来,下载教材和代码示例,开启你的深度学习实践之旅吧!相信通过系统的学习和实践,你一定能在深度学习领域取得显著的进步。
该文章由dudu123.com嘟嘟 ai 导航整理,嘟嘟 AI 导航汇集全网优质网址资源和最新优质 AI 工具